>> This includes fixes for GCC/clang warnings, memory leaks, memory
>> corruption and few other minor fixes. The UTF-8 and UTF-16 is not
>> entirely fixed and I removed the work-in-progress patches.
>>
>> Changes since v1 are:
>> 1. Group all patches based on prefix (unit file), instead of topic.
>> 2. Put the build-related patches at the end.
>> 3. Remove all CI-related patches.
>> 4. Drop patch: ndef: fix parsing of UTF-16 text payload.
>> 5. Fix commit msg in: nfctool: pass the format as string literal

> FYI, I built neard natively with these patches applied on an amd64
> (ubuntu 20.04) and an ARM Cortext A8 (debian 10).  Both build cleanly
> and I could read & write tags.
> 
> My plans include:
> - python3-ize the python test scripts
> - debug an issue I think I saw
> - look for races that I recall running into in the past
> - recruit another arm SoC for testing
> - get my trf7970 working again
